Why Invest in a Custom Boat Cover?

1. Superior Protection Against the Elements

Ontario’s climate poses unique challenges: harsh UV rays in the summer, relentless rain in spring and fall, and heavy snow in winter. A custom-fit boat cover shields your investment from:

  • UV damage and fading
  • Mold, mildew, and rot caused by moisture
  • Debris, dirt, and animal intrusion
  • Ice and snow buildup during off-season storage

 

2. The Perfect Fit

Unlike universal covers, custom boat covers match your vessel’s exact contours—ensuring complete coverage, minimizing flapping in the wind, and preventing water pooling, which can lead to fabric damage and leaks.

 

3. Enhanced Security

A properly fitted cover discourages theft by concealing valuable items and restricting unauthorized access to your boat.

 

4. Increased Resale Value

A well-protected boat not only looks better but retains higher value. Covers prevent premature wear, helping interiors and exteriors stay pristine longer.

 

Custom vs. Universal Covers: What’s Best for Your Boat?

Custom covers are tailored to your exact boat make and model. They fit like a glove, maximize protection, and typically last longer. Oshawa marine upholstery shops and specialist manufacturers offer custom solutions, measuring your boat and constructing covers based on its unique features.

Universal fit covers come in preset sizes and are more affordable, but may leave gaps and require more frequent adjustments. If you do opt for a universal cover, insist on marine-grade materials and features like reinforced seams and adjustable straps for a more secure fit.

What to Expect from a Professional Service

  • Assessment: Measure your boat and consult on the best cover type for your specific usage—storage, transport, or everyday protection.
  • Material Selection: Advice on premium marine-grade fabrics like acrylic, polyester, or Sunbrella for ultimate weather-resistance.
  • Installation: Secure, tailored fitting with reinforced seams, venting to prevent mildew, and durable straps or snaps.
  • Repairs and Upgrades: Inspection and restoration of aging covers, zipper or seam repair, and replacement installations.

 

Choosing the Right Boat Carpet for Ontario’s Lakes

Boat flooring demands durability and comfort. Ontario’s lakes present frequent wet conditions, muddy shoes, and potential UV exposure. The right carpet ensures comfort underfoot, slip resistance, and defense against mold.

Key Considerations

  • Material Matters: Choose marine-grade carpet materials such as polypropylene or olefin, which resist moisture, mildew, and UV damage. These fibers are engineered to withstand Canada’s climate and the frequent wet-dry cycle of Ontario lakes.
  • Texture and Safety: Look for non-skid, textured surfaces to prevent slips—especially crucial on wet decks and swim platforms.
  • Colour Choice: Darker carpets hide dirt and wear, while lighter options don’t retain as much heat but may stain more easily.
  • Thickness and Comfort: Balance durability and cushioning. A mid-weight, 20oz marine carpet offers robust performance, while thicker carpets add comfort at the cost of quicker drying times.
  • UV Resistance: The best carpets are UV-stabilized to maintain colour and structural integrity throughout hot summers.
  • Custom Fit vs. Pre-Made: Like covers, pre-made carpets are quick to install but may lack the precision fit and finish of custom jobs. Custom carpets match your boat’s flooring perfectly and are cut and installed by professionals for a seamless look.

Additional Ways to Safeguard Your Boat

Regular Cleaning and Maintenance

  • Wash and air out both covers and carpeting after heavy use.
  • Treat canvas covers with waterproofing sprays and UV protectants periodically.
  • Inspect for signs of wear, small tears, or sticky zippers early—prompt repairs extend component life.

Tips for the Best Boat Protection in Oshawa

  • Always store your boat covered—whether at home, in a slip, or on the trailer.
  • For seasonal storage, choose a mooring cover for stationary protection and a travel cover for highway trips.
  • Opt for professional installation where possible, especially on valuable or high-end vessels.
  • Maintain a regular inspection and care routine for both covers and carpets, ideally before and after each boating season.
